It defines an OS as system software that manages hardware resources and allows communication between hardware and user programs. It notes OS provides interfaces, allocates resources like memory and processors, and manages files. Popular OS types include batch, time-sharing, real-time, distributed, network, and mobile OS. The functions of an OS are described as providing interfaces, loading programs, coordinating hardware/software interaction, and managing file storage and retrieval.
